Marriage above 50 years of age: How Indians are breaking norms?

February 5, 2019 by shadibyahwale No Comments

More and more silver singles are opting to marry in India. And it’s no more stigma, at least for those who have decided to marry at this age. In 2011, Hindi Cinema actor Suhasini Mulay married at the age of 60 and created headlines. Ever since there has been a steady change that’s becoming visible in Indian society.

There are people who lost their spouse or their first marriage ended in divorce, and who have lived more than half their lives to realize that they need a partner now more than at any point in life. There are also cases of people who remained single until 50 and married again.
